Body

Authorship and Creation

The Asthenic Syndrome's director is recorded as Kira Muratova[5]. Screenwriters include Kira Muratova[6], Leonid Sergeyevich Popov[7], and Aleksandr Chernykh[8]. Cast members include Viktor Aristov[11], Olga Antonova[12], Leonid Sergeyevich Popov[13], Natalya Buzko[14], Galina Kasperovich[15], and Oleksandra Svenska[16].

Publication

Publication dates include +1989-12-01T00:00:00Z[27], +1990-02-19T00:00:00Z[28], +1990-03-13T00:00:00Z[29], +1990-08-01T00:00:00Z[30], and +1991-01-17T00:00:00Z[31]. The Asthenic Syndrome's original language of film or TV show is recorded as Russian[23]. Genres include drama film[9] and crime film[10].

Reception

The Asthenic Syndrome received the Silver Bear Grand Jury Prize[3].
